Chocolate Covered Pretzel Bones Recipe

Description

These Chocolate Covered Pretzel Bones are a fun and festive treat perfect for Halloween or any spooky-themed party. Crunchy pretzel rods are dipped in creamy white candy melts and adorned with mini marshmallows to resemble bones, making them a playful and easy no-bake snack that kids and adults will love.


Ingredients

Scale

Ingredients

  • 6 pretzel rods (Use rods, not sticks!)
  • 24 mini marshmallows
  • 1 package white candy melts (about 8-10 ounces)


Instructions

  1. Prepare the Pretzels: Break each pretzel rod in half to create 12 pieces, which will form the ‘bones’. Set aside.
  2. Melt Candy: Melt the white candy melts according to package instructions, typically in 15-30 second increments in the microwave, stirring thoroughly after each interval until smooth and creamy.
  3. Dip and Add Marshmallows: Dip one smooth end of a pretzel piece into the melted candy, then immediately press two mini marshmallows onto the dipped end to form the ‘bone joints’. Repeat for all 12 pretzel halves. Let these set for about 5 minutes to harden slightly.
  4. Cover with Candy Coating: Dip each marshmallow-tipped end along with about two-thirds of the pretzel rod into the white candy melts, ensuring the marshmallows and a portion of the rod are coated. Let them rest until the coating firms up.
  5. Repeat on Other End: Repeat the dipping process on the opposite end of each pretzel piece, forming the other ‘bone joint’, and place them on wax paper to cool and set completely at room temperature. Do not refrigerate.

Notes

  • Use pretzel rods (thicker) instead of thin pretzel sticks for better structure.
  • Allow candy coating to set at room temperature; refrigeration can cause cracking.
  • If candy melts harden during dipping, reheat in short microwave bursts to maintain smoothness.
  • These treats are best consumed within 2-3 days for optimal freshness.
